There’s been plenty of unhappiness with the current State of Origin format with criticism that it affects the quality of regular NRL games, reports Triple M’s Supergrass,

“I can tell you the NRL will announce in future that Games I and III will be on Wednesday night with Game II in-between will be on a Sunday with no NRL games that week,” said Supergrass, on Triple M Grill Team.

“The most controversial game, though, is about growing the game interstate.

“Under the new format Sydney and Brisbane will only have one game every two years. Game I will be in Melbourne, Game II in Perth and Game III will rotate between Sydney and Brisbane annually.” Listen to the full audio below.
